Anti-Terrorism Court Extends Interim Bail for Fawad Chaudhry

An anti-terrorism court (ATC) held hearings regarding interim bail applications filed by former federal minister Fawad Chaudhry in five cases related to the May 9 violent incidents.

During the proceedings, ATC Judge Manzar Ali Gul approved one request for exemption from personal appearance. The court extended his interim bail until May 7 and requested arguments from the lawyers in the next hearing.
